Tony Winner Andrea Martin to Return to Provincetown, 6/28-29
by BWW
News Desk
- Jun 28, 2014
Andrea Martin is a two-time Emmy Award winner for the critically acclaimed sketch comedy series SCTV, and is also a two-time Tony Award winner. She won her second and most recent Tony Award last June of 2013 for her performance as Berthe in the Broadway revival of "Pippin" directed by Diane Paulus and her first award was for the musical 'My Favorite Year.' She is currently starring on Broadway at Lincoln Center in "Act One" by James Lapine opposite Tony Shalhoub. She is also filming a new television sitcom "Working The Engels" written by Katie Ford ("Miss Congeniality," "Desperate Housewives") which is now filming in Toronto. On June 28 and 29, this comic star of stage and screen returns to Broadway@ The Art House for the first time since its inaugural season in 2011. Mary Walsh Brings DANCING WITH RAGE to the Panasonic Theatre, Beginning Today
by BWW News Desk
- Mar 5, 2013
Canadian actress, comedienne and social activist Mary Walsh comes to the Panasonic Theatre in Toronto with her latest production of Dancing With Rage. Mary has created a new show that incorporates all the characters she has played over the years, including the infamous warrior princess, Marg Delahunty, with her armour-plated breasts and razor-sharp wit to 'cut through all the BS.'
